The KSDE Child Nutrition and Wellness (CNW) team will be hosting a required procurement training for School Nutrition Program (SNP) sponsors on Jan. 22.
Per the Child Nutrition Program Integrity Final Rule, school nutrition program directors, management, and/or staff who work on procurement activities must complete procurement training annually. For the 2025-26 school year, all sponsors must complete procurement training by June 30.
